About the Role

We are partnering with a leading semiconductor manufacturer specializing in ultra-low power, low-voltage integrated circuits used across automotive, consumer, industrial, and wireless applications.

We are looking for a System Architect to lead the system-level architecture of RFID IC products, with strong focus on real-world usage within end-to-end RFID ecosystems.

Reporting to the Technical Leader of the RFID Business Unit, you will work at the intersection of system engineering, IC design, and product strategy—shaping how RFID products integrate into future UHF and NFC ecosystems. You will collaborate closely with IC designers, product managers, application engineers, and customers, while actively contributing to industry standards and forums.

Responsibilities

  • RFID Standards & Ecosystem
    • Monitor RFID standards, market trends, and competitive technologies
    • Actively participate in standards organizations and industry forums
    • Identify innovation opportunities and differentiation at system level
    • Represent the company at customer meetings, webinars, and tradeshows
  • System-Level Design
    • Define product-level requirements and device specifications
    • Translate customer use cases into system and IC requirements
    • Collaborate with IC design teams to refine and implement system architecture
    • Develop and maintain high-level functional IC models (e.g., Python)
    • Perform system performance analysis (timing, power consumption, behavior)
  • Product & Sales Support
    • Support product management and sales by articulating system-level value and features
    • Deliver technical training with application engineers (internal & external)
    • Act as RFID subject matter expert for advanced customer use cases
  •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field
  • 5+ years of experience in system engineering, IC design, or product management within the semiconductor industry
  • Hands-on experience with RFID technologies (tags, readers, EPC Gen2, NFC)
  • Deep understanding of UHF and NFC RFID ecosystems (tag → reader → software → system)
  • Strong understanding of the semiconductor development lifecycle
  • Ability to translate customer requirements into system and device specifications
  • Willingness to travel ~10%
  • Autonomous, proactive, and results-driven
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ving mindset
  • Comfortable working cross-functionally with engineering, product, and sales
  • Confident communicator with customers and technical stakeholders
